Private Equity Investment in Indian Real Estate Surges by 93% - A Q3 2024 Snapshot
Real Estate News:Private equity investment inflows into the Indian real estate sector have reached a substantial USD 2.2 billion (INR 186 billion) in Q3 2024, marking a remarkable 93% growth on a sequential basis. This amount is more than double the investment volume recorded in the same period last year. Additionally, the year-to-date (YTD) inflows from January to September 2024 have surpassed the total investment quantum of the entire year 2023, standing at USD 3.9 billion (INR 329 billion).

The latest report by Savills India, a prominent global real estate consulting firm, highlights that the industrial and logistics segment topped the charts, capturing 77% of the total investment volume at USD 1.7 billion (INR 144 billion). This surge can be attributed to the growing demand from e-commerce players and the government's efforts to position India as a major manufacturing hub.

The commercial office segment followed closely, accounting for 21% of the overall private equity (PE) investments. Notably, all investments in this sector were sourced from foreign investors, who focused on core assets in key cities like Chennai, Mumbai, and NCR. These investments underscore the continued confidence in India's real estate market, driven by its robust economic growth and strategic geographical advantages.

The significant increase in PE investments in the industrial and logistics sectors indicates a strong belief in India's potential as a global supply chain hub. The government's initiatives, such as the Production-Linked Incentive (PLI) schemes and the development of industrial corridors, have played a crucial role in attracting these investments. These efforts are not only boosting the real estate sector but also contributing to the country's economic growth and job creation.

In the commercial office segment, foreign investors’ interest in core assets reflects their confidence in the long-term prospects of India's urban centers. Cities like Chennai, Mumbai, and NCR are known for their economic vibrancy and strong business ecosystems, making them attractive destinations for office spaces.

The rise in private equity investments in the Indian real estate sector is a positive indicator of the market's resilience and potential. As the country continues to focus on infrastructure development and economic reforms, the real estate market is expected to witness sustained growth in the coming years.
